The Operations Command (Kdo Op) is responsible for all military operations and missions of the Swiss Army. The Kdo Op includes, among others, the Air Force, the Army, the four territorial divisions, the SWISSINT competence center, the Special Forces Command, and the Military Police. Around 40 % of the approx. 2,500 employees are civil servants -- from engineers to aircraft mechanics to analysts.
The Swiss Army employs over 9,000 employees in four military and around 200 civil professions -- and this at 110 locations throughout Switzerland. Provision is also made for new talent: The Swiss Army trains apprentices in over 30 professions.
